Best Spiritual Gift Ideas for Festivals
Choosing the perfect spiritual gift depends on the occasion and the recipient's preferences. Some timeless options include:
Brass Diyas
A beautifully designed brass diya symbolizes light, wisdom, and prosperity. It is one of the most popular gifts for Diwali, Navratri, and housewarming ceremonies.
Marble and Brass Idols
Sacred idols of Lord Ganesha, Lakshmi, Krishna, Shiva, Radha Krishna, or Hanuman are meaningful gifts that bring devotion and elegance to any prayer space.
Tulsi Mala and Rudraksha Mala
Prayer malas are thoughtful gifts for devotees who practice mantra chanting, meditation, or daily worship.
Puja Thali Sets
A decorative puja thali with essential worship items makes a practical and beautiful gift for newly married couples, families, and festival celebrations.
Puja Gift Hampers
Festival hampers containing diyas, incense sticks, camphor, kumkum, roli, chandan, and sweets make complete spiritual gift packages.
Home Temple Accessories
Bell, incense holders, kalash, conch shells, and decorative puja accessories are excellent gifts that enhance daily worship.

Best Spiritual Gifts for Parents, Friends, and Family
Every relationship deserves a thoughtful gift. Spiritual gifts are suitable for almost every recipient.
For Parents and Elders
Gift marble idols, brass diyas, Tulsi Malas, Rudraksha Malas, or complete puja kits that support their daily devotional practices.
For Friends
Choose decorative incense holders, spiritual books, prayer beads, or compact home temple accessories that inspire positivity.
For Newly Married Couples
Puja thali sets, Lakshmi-Ganesha idols, brass bells, and elegant home temple décor make meaningful wedding and festival gifts.
For Corporate Gifting
Premium spiritual hampers, decorative diyas, and handcrafted idols are thoughtful choices for clients and employees during festive occasions.
